My British colleague has GU halogens in the ceiling of his house in Nigeria, which keep blowing with the voltage fluctuations. He also has a 12v invertor for the times when there's no power (most of the time).

He would like to replace the old halogen bulbs with LEDs in the hope that they won't blow so easily. He says he has both types of bulb - 240v with the fat brass bayonet terminals and others marked 220v with the spindly push fit terminals - is this possible? I thought push-fit was always 12volt?

Can somebody explain all this? What kind of bulbs would you recommend?
